金融数据挖掘技术应用-第1篇.docxVIP

  • 2
  • 0
  • 约2.03万字
  • 约 31页
  • 2026-01-05 发布于上海
  • 举报

PAGE1/NUMPAGES1

金融数据挖掘技术应用

TOC\o1-3\h\z\u

第一部分金融数据挖掘技术原理 2

第二部分数据预处理与特征工程 5

第三部分模型选择与算法优化 10

第四部分实时数据处理与预测分析 13

第五部分风险评估与市场预测 17

第六部分模型评估与性能优化 20

第七部分金融数据安全与隐私保护 23

第八部分技术应用与行业影响 27

第一部分金融数据挖掘技术原理

关键词

关键要点

金融数据挖掘技术原理概述

1.金融数据挖掘技术是通过机器学习和统计分析方法从海量金融数据中提取有价值的信息,用于预测市场趋势、识别风险信号和优化投资策略。

2.该技术依赖于数据预处理、特征工程、模型训练与评估等步骤,结合实时数据流处理技术,实现动态分析与决策支持。

3.随着大数据和人工智能的发展,金融数据挖掘技术正朝着自动化、智能化方向演进,提升数据处理效率与模型准确性。

基于机器学习的预测模型

1.机器学习算法如随机森林、支持向量机(SVM)和深度学习模型被广泛应用于金融预测,能够处理非线性关系和高维数据。

2.通过历史交易数据、市场指标和经济变量构建预测模型,提升对市场波动和价格变化的识别能力。

3.随着计算能力的提升,模型训练速度加快,模型泛化能力增强,推动金融预测的精准度和实用性提升。

特征工程与数据预处理

1.金融数据具有高维度、非线性、噪声多等特点,特征工程是数据挖掘的基础,需通过标准化、归一化、特征选择等方法提升数据质量。

2.采用主成分分析(PCA)和t-SNE等降维技术,有效减少冗余信息,提高模型训练效率。

3.结合自然语言处理(NLP)技术,从文本数据中提取金融事件信息,增强模型的多源数据整合能力。

实时金融数据流处理

1.金融数据具有实时性、动态性,需采用流式计算框架(如ApacheKafka、Flink)实现数据的实时处理与分析。

2.实时数据流处理技术能够及时捕捉市场变化,支持高频交易和风险预警系统,提升决策响应速度。

3.结合边缘计算和云计算,实现数据在本地与云端的协同处理,降低延迟并提高系统稳定性。

金融数据挖掘在风险管理中的应用

1.通过挖掘历史风险数据,识别潜在的信用风险、市场风险和操作风险,为风险评估和资本配置提供依据。

2.利用聚类分析和异常检测技术,识别异常交易行为,防范欺诈和市场操纵。

3.结合深度学习模型,构建动态风险评估系统,实现风险指标的实时监控与动态调整。

金融数据挖掘的技术挑战与未来趋势

1.数据质量、模型可解释性、计算资源消耗是当前金融数据挖掘面临的主要挑战。

2.未来趋势包括多模态数据融合、联邦学习与隐私保护技术的应用,以及AI与金融业务的深度融合。

3.随着生成式AI和大模型的发展,金融数据挖掘将更加注重智能化、个性化和场景化应用,推动行业数字化转型。

金融数据挖掘技术在现代金融领域中扮演着日益重要的角色,其核心在于通过先进的数据分析方法,从海量的金融数据中提取有价值的信息,以支持决策制定、风险评估、市场预测及投资策略优化等关键业务活动。本文将从技术原理的角度,系统阐述金融数据挖掘的基本概念、主要方法及应用机制。

金融数据挖掘技术的核心在于利用数据挖掘算法对金融数据进行分析,以发现隐藏的模式、趋势和关系。金融数据通常包含多种类型,如历史价格、交易记录、市场指数、宏观经济指标、公司财务数据等。这些数据具有高度的非线性、动态性和复杂性,因此,金融数据挖掘需要采用能够处理高维数据、非线性关系以及时间序列特性的算法。

首先,金融数据挖掘通常基于数据预处理阶段,包括数据清洗、特征工程、数据标准化等步骤。数据清洗旨在去除噪声、处理缺失值和异常值,以提高数据质量。特征工程则通过选择和构造合适的特征变量,将原始数据转化为适合挖掘的格式。数据标准化则是为了消除不同数据量纲的影响,使模型能够更公平地比较不同维度的数据。

在数据挖掘阶段,常用的技术包括分类、回归、聚类、关联规则挖掘、时间序列分析等。分类算法如支持向量机(SVM)、决策树、随机森林等,用于预测金融事件(如股票价格变动、信用风险评估);回归算法如线性回归、决策树回归,用于预测连续型金融指标;聚类算法如K-means、层次聚类,用于对金融资产进行分类和分组;关联规则挖掘则用于发现变量间的潜在关系,如交易数据中商品之间的关联;时间序列分析则用于识别金融市场的周期性变化和趋势。

此外,金融数据挖掘还广泛应用机器学习和深度学习技术。机器学习方法如神经网络、随机森林、梯度提升树(GBD

文档评论(0)

1亿VIP精品文档

相关文档